# Fan-out backpressure knobs for the Pellomark notifier.
# QUEUE_HIGH_WATERMARK caps in-flight batches; lower it if consumers lag.
# DRAIN_INTERVAL_MS controls retry pacing. Don't touch FANOUT_SHARDS mid-incident;
# it forces a rebalance. If paging storms persist, halve the watermark first.
# The broker credential that authorizes drain commands goes on the next line.

vault entry, kafog-yahop: COURIER_KEY8=0faa53ae

Handing off the Quillbus broker upgrade (4.x to 5.1) to Dario. Cluster is half-migrated; mixed-version mode is supported but TLS cert rotation must finish before cutover. No auth model changes, though the admin API gained two new endpoints worth reviewing. Open questions and the migration checklist are tracked on the internal page below.

dashboard of taduf-bawef = https://jira.lumicsys.internal/projects/display/browse/b1cbf89d

Title: Scheduler double-waters bed 3 after DST shift

New folks: the Verdella scheduler stores watering slots in local time. After the clock change, slot 06:00 fires twice, soaking the herb bed. Fix: store UTC, convert at display. Repro on the Oakhollow test rig only. To reproduce, install the firmware identified by the token below.

build token for hafop-kahog: htk31_a432ac515d5bb1362002c1e1a7e80ef